[PATCH] D83614: [NewPM] Add back some codegen IR pass test removed in ebc88811b5c9ed

Yuanfang Chen via Phabricator via llvm-commits llvm-commits at lists.llvm.org
Fri Jul 10 19:28:34 PDT 2020


ychen created this revision.
Herald added a project: LLVM.
Herald added a subscriber: llvm-commits.

Repository:
  rG LLVM Github Monorepo

https://reviews.llvm.org/D83614

Files:
  llvm/test/CodeGen/X86/unreachableblockelim.ll
  llvm/test/Transforms/PreISelIntrinsicLowering/load-relative.ll
  llvm/test/Transforms/PreISelIntrinsicLowering/objc-arc.ll


Index: llvm/test/Transforms/PreISelIntrinsicLowering/objc-arc.ll
===================================================================
--- llvm/test/Transforms/PreISelIntrinsicLowering/objc-arc.ll
+++ llvm/test/Transforms/PreISelIntrinsicLowering/objc-arc.ll
@@ -1,4 +1,5 @@
 ; RUN: opt -pre-isel-intrinsic-lowering -S -o - %s | FileCheck %s
+; RUN: llc -enable-new-pm -passes='pre-isel-intrinsic-lowering' < %s | FileCheck %s
 
 ; Make sure calls to the objc intrinsics are translated to calls in to the
 ; runtime
Index: llvm/test/Transforms/PreISelIntrinsicLowering/load-relative.ll
===================================================================
--- llvm/test/Transforms/PreISelIntrinsicLowering/load-relative.ll
+++ llvm/test/Transforms/PreISelIntrinsicLowering/load-relative.ll
@@ -1,4 +1,5 @@
 ; RUN: opt -pre-isel-intrinsic-lowering -S -o - %s | FileCheck %s
+; RUN: llc -enable-new-pm -passes='pre-isel-intrinsic-lowering' < %s | FileCheck %s
 
 ; CHECK: define i8* @foo32(i8* [[P:%.*]], i32 [[O:%.*]])
 define i8* @foo32(i8* %p, i32 %o) {
Index: llvm/test/CodeGen/X86/unreachableblockelim.ll
===================================================================
--- llvm/test/CodeGen/X86/unreachableblockelim.ll
+++ llvm/test/CodeGen/X86/unreachableblockelim.ll
@@ -1,4 +1,5 @@
 ; RUN: opt -S < %s -unreachableblockelim | FileCheck %s
+; RUN: llc -enable-new-pm -passes='unreachableblockelim' < %s | FileCheck %s
 
 target datalayout = "e-m:e-i64:64-f80:128-n8:16:32:64-S128"
 target triple = "x86_64-unknown-linux-gnu"


-------------- next part --------------
A non-text attachment was scrubbed...
Name: D83614.277206.patch
Type: text/x-patch
Size: 1530 bytes
Desc: not available
URL: <http://lists.llvm.org/pipermail/llvm-commits/attachments/20200711/02607813/attachment.bin>


More information about the llvm-commits mailing list